Arkansas Statutes

§ 20-27-2401 — Findings

Arkansas·Title 20

The General Assembly finds that:

(1)Herbal snuff is a tobaccoless snuff, available as loose composition or in pouches, that is primarily marketed as an adult alternative for moist smokeless tobacco;
(2)Herbal snuff is marketed in flavors that are similar to those of the leading moist smokeless tobacco brands;
(3)Herbal snuff is not a tobacco product and therefore is not subject to tobacco taxes, advertising restrictions, or merchandising restrictions;
(4)Even though herbal snuff is regulated by the United States Food and Drug Administration as a food product and manufacturers are required to follow United States Food and Drug Administration guidelines, herbal snuff is intended to be an adult-oriented product;
